CAGAYAN de Oro City Mayor Vicente Emano and his son Misamis Oriental Representative Yevgeny "Bambi" Emano (2nd district) are expected to grace the opening of the 1st Mayor's Cup Summer chess tournament here at the SM City today, Friday.
"Barring unforeseen glitches, maka-uban gyod nato ang amahan ug anak sama sa niaging opening sa atong inter-barangay basketball sa SM City," overall event coordinator Gerardo "Boboy" Sabal told Sun.Star Cagayan de Oro.
The younger Emano, who also bankrolled the province's ongoing summer sports clinics in six events, earlier said that providing the youth a wholesome activity where they can showcase their potential is vital in building a progressive community.
"Before nagsulod ko sa pulitika until now part na gyod ang sports sa akong kinabuhi. Maayo ang epekto niini physically and mentally mao nga ato usab i-share sa uban natong kaigsoonan," then said Emano in a casual talk with this writer.
Around 400 young and old woodpushers, who are bonafide residents of Cagayan de Oro, are deemed to duel it out in the summer chessfest with juicy cash prizes at stake and free shirts to be given before the opening round matches.
The competition has no registration fee.
Aside from the open division, featuring the city's titled players and top non masters, exciting events in the age-group level is also set to enliven the summer chess festival.
"Alegre sab kaayo ‘ning sa age-group level kay atong mga top kiddies and juniors nga nakadula na sa gawas (Asean chess) ingon man ang mga veteran Palaro players nga bag-o lang gyod naka-abot from the annual national students meet in Lingayen, Pangasinan nagpalista na usab nga motampo," said tournament director Lorenzo "Jun" Cuizon.
